I was wondering about compatability between some anemones. I currently have a bubble tip, and was wondering if I could also get a carpet anemone. Are carpet anemones docile or possibly hostile? Im not worried about clownfish compatability because my clowns are occupied with the bubble tip. I want it more to just fill out the tank a little bit.

Has anyone ever had a carpet anemone? And if so, how did it go behavior wise?

I only keep rock flower anemones, but from what I've read, carpets tend to travel more than most nems and pack an evil sting. I would think that if your nems came in contact, one would move away from the other. I personally just steer clear of the carpets. I'm sure someone with experience will chime in.
